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Mandell Park
Mandell Park
Park ·
Montrose, Houston
Directions
HOURS
Closing Soon
6 RATINGS
50%
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Foursquare
Ratings
Overall
50%
6 ratings
Good to Know
Good for Kids
Details
Hours
Every Day
7:00
AM
-
11:00
PM
Closing Soon
Phone
+1 (713) 524-4285
Address
4399 Mandell St
Houston, TX 77006
United States